This patch adds a combined pattern for combining vfsqrt.v and vcond_mask.

gcc/ChangeLog:

        * config/riscv/autovec-opt.md (*cond_<optab><mode>):
        Add sqrt + vcond_mask combine pattern.
        * config/riscv/autovec.md (<optab><mode>2):
        Change define_expand to define_insn_and_split.

gcc/testsuite/ChangeLog:

        * gcc.target/riscv/rvv/autovec/cond/cond_sqrt-1.c: New test.
        * gcc.target/riscv/rvv/autovec/cond/cond_sqrt-2.c: New test.
        * gcc.target/riscv/rvv/autovec/cond/cond_sqrt_run-1.c: New test.
        * gcc.target/riscv/rvv/autovec/cond/cond_sqrt_run-2.c: New test.

diff --git a/gcc/config/riscv/autovec-opt.md b/gcc/config/riscv/autovec-opt.md
index 1ca5ce97193..d9863c76654 100644
--- a/gcc/config/riscv/autovec-opt.md
+++ b/gcc/config/riscv/autovec-opt.md
@@ -730,6 +730,26 @@
   DONE;
 })
 
+;; Combine vfsqrt.v and cond_mask
+(define_insn_and_split "*cond_<optab><mode>"
+  [(set (match_operand:VF 0 "register_operand")
+     (if_then_else:VF
+       (match_operand:<VM> 1 "register_operand")
+       (any_float_unop:VF
+         (match_operand:VF 2 "register_operand"))
+       (match_operand:VF 3 "register_operand")))]
+  "TARGET_VECTOR && can_create_pseudo_p ()"
+  "#"
+  "&& 1"
+  [(const_int 0)]
+{
+  insn_code icode = code_for_pred (<CODE>, <MODE>mode);
+  rtx ops[] = {operands[0], operands[1], operands[2], operands[3],
+               gen_int_mode (GET_MODE_NUNITS (<MODE>mode), Pmode)};
+  riscv_vector::expand_cond_len_unop (icode, ops);
+  DONE;
+})
+
